Output 894e1b6e37153bf096813789eaf78d44cd668d20da15e8d5482ec010c3c8cf21:3

value
17344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5968a33d529872cab6b19dcee5f4f077bb6e0fb OP_EQUAL
address
3Q5ZpEZRLegMyFFcq6oeAAt8ynR81tEazN
transaction
894e1b6e37153bf096813789eaf78d44cd668d20da15e8d5482ec010c3c8cf21
confirmations
66603
spent
true